Who needs arlington national cemetery?

01
Arlington National Cemetery is primarily for individuals who meet specific eligibility requirements for military veterans and their family members.
02
Military Veterans: Arlington National Cemetery provides burial services for honorably discharged veterans of the United States Armed Forces. This includes Army, Navy, Air Force, Marines, Coast Guard, and others.
03
Active Duty Service Members: Active duty service members who die while serving in the military and meet the eligibility criteria can also be buried at Arlington National Cemetery.
04
Retired Service Members: Retired military personnel who served a minimum of 20 years or were medically retired and their spouses are eligible for burial at Arlington National Cemetery.
05
Medal of Honor Recipients: Individuals who have been awarded the Medal of Honor, the highest military decoration, are eligible for burial with full military honors at Arlington National Cemetery.
06
Eligible Family Members: Spouses, unmarried minor children, and adult unmarried children of eligible veterans or service members may also be buried at Arlington National Cemetery.
07
Other Eligible Individuals: In some cases, individuals who have made significant contributions to the United States can be considered for burial at Arlington National Cemetery.

Arlington National Cemetery is a military cemetery located in Arlington, Virginia, established during the Civil War, that serves as the final resting place for many U.S. military personnel, veterans, and notable figures.
There is no 'filing' requirement specifically for Arlington National Cemetery; however, qualifying service members, veterans, and certain dignitaries may be eligible for burial in the cemetery.
To apply for burial at Arlington National Cemetery, eligible individuals must complete the application process through the cemetery's official website or contact the cemetery administration for guidance.
The purpose of Arlington National Cemetery is to honor and memorialize U.S. military personnel, veterans, and notable individuals for their service and sacrifice to the country.
For burial applications, information such as the deceased's service record, date of birth, date of death, and relationship to the applicant must be provided.
